Different skins, different things
#1
My idea is that skins could come as "packs".

This way they could have their own start-up logo and their own keymaps.

It would make things a lot easier to set up for the way each person likes to use XBMC. Instead of having to copy over a skin, then a logo, then a new keymap, etc etc.

It would also mean that one could jump from one skin to another a lot easier, if the skin was incharge of the logo and keymap.

For example, the current default keymap just doesn't quite fit the needs of the MC360 skin.

I disagree with keymaps on a per skin basis. Too much xml to manage.
Having the logo in the skin might be a good idea. Right now xTV displays its own logo after the XBMC splash screen which is kinda cludgy.
The problem I think is that the splash screen is rendered before any of the xml is parsed..

A good solution is for skins to bundle in their own tiny script that will swap the splash screen in and out and place it in skin options.
